Diagnosis
ReferenceDiagnosis
J. Colmenar et al. 2014Strongly dorsibiconvex shells with transversely suboval outline. Ventral muscle field large, gently impressed; diductor scars flabellate, widely divergent anteriorly, more elongated than wide and ranging from 54 to 82 per cent as long as valve length and 36 to 95 per cent as wide as maximum valve width; marked development of both adjustor and diductor scars.
